All finished pieces are created from photos that I have taken of Birch Trees. All color, depth, texture and fold is composed of the photographical structure of the Birch Tree Bark and a little bit of background in the picture that was behind the Birch Trees in the original photos.

Pan : Ditso
Celestial Body : Wasp-17b
An exoplanet in the constellation Scorpius that is orbiting the star WASP-17
It's orbit is retrograde to the orbit of it's host star
Ditsö̀ is the name that the god Sibö̀ gave to the first Bribri people in Talamancan mythology.
(Information from Wikipedia)
